Ansible自动化部署K8S集群 1.1 Ansible介绍 Ansible是一种IT自动化工具。它可以配置系统,部署软件以及协调更高级的IT任务,例如持续部署,滚动更新。Ansible适用于管理企业IT基础设施,从具有少数主机的小规模到数千个实例的企业环境。Ansible也是一种简单 ...
kubespray ansible 自动化安装k s集群 https: github.com kubernetes incubator kubespray https: kubernetes.io docs setup pick right solution kubespray本质是一堆ansible的role文件,通过这种方式,即ansible方式可以自动化的安装高可用k s集群,目前支持 . ...
2017-12-27 23:57 1 7566 推荐指数:
Ansible自动化部署K8S集群 1.1 Ansible介绍 Ansible是一种IT自动化工具。它可以配置系统,部署软件以及协调更高级的IT任务,例如持续部署,滚动更新。Ansible适用于管理企业IT基础设施,从具有少数主机的小规模到数千个实例的企业环境。Ansible也是一种简单 ...
Kubespray 是 Kubernetes incubator 中的项目,目标是提供 Production Ready Kubernetes 部署方案,该项目基础是通过 Ansible Playbook 来定义系统与 Kubernetes 集群部署的任务,具有以下几个特点: l 可以部署 ...
最近在看kubespray的ansible-playbook自动化部署流程,对ansible的使用有了新的理解,为了加深对kubespray的理解,计划改造一套完全离线安装的kubespray版本,有什么问题建议,欢迎大家随时指出。 kubespray GitHub地址为: https ...
1. clone代码 git clone https://github.com/kubernetes-incubator/kubespray.git 2. 添加inventory/inventory 单独添加ansible inventory放到inventory目录下 添加后 ...
1、集群规划,如下所示: 主机名 ip地址 角色 端口号 k8s-master 192.168.110.133 k8s-master api-server:8080 ...
项目地址:https://github.com/easzlab/kubeasz ...
1.参考这篇文章: https://github.com/kubernetes/dashboard/wiki/Creating-sample-user 创建用户 2.获取token 3.kub ...
1. 硬件要求 Master机器至少满足2C4G,负载节点不做要求,最少是1C1G。 2. Centos安装 1. 脚本安装 PS:在安装前请确保已经安装了Docker,具体的DockerDokcer安装 具体部署方法如下(在所有master和node节点部署): 该脚本内容 ...